Diferența dintre ROLAP și MOLAP

ROLAP înseamnă procesare analitică relațională online, care este o formă de OLAP (procesare analitică online). ROLAP analizează o cantitate mare de date pe dimensiuni multiple. MOLAP reprezintă procesare analitică online multidimensională, care este o formă de OLAP (procesare analitică online). A stocat date sub forma unui tablou. Pentru a stoca aceste date, MOLAP folosește baze de date de stocare multidimensionale (MDDB)

Ce este ROLAP?

Poate gestiona un volum mare de date folosind un model de bază de date relațional. ROLAP se află între capătul frontal și cel din spate al sistemului și stochează în mod eficient datele fiecărui depozit.

Avantajele ROLAP

  • Deoarece folosește un model de bază de date relațional, serverele ROLAP pot fi ușor integrate cu un sistem relațional de gestionare a bazelor de date.
  • ROLAP gestionează eficient o cantitate mare de date
  • Serverele DSS ale Microsoft urmează abordarea ROLAP pentru a gestiona eficient datele.

Dezavantaje ROLAP

  • Viteza de răspuns la interogare este mică.
  • Există unele limitări ale scalabilității.

Ce este MOLAP?

MOLAP este o prelucrare analitică online multidimensională. Creează cuburi de date pentru a prelua datele din mai multe dimensiuni. Pentru tratarea datelor se utilizează tehnologia matricială împrăștiată.

Avantajele MOLAP

  • Viteza de răspuns la interogare este mare, de aceea îi ajută pe utilizatorii conectați la rețea să analizeze datele într-o manieră mai bună.
  • Datorită interfeței simple, este ușor de utilizat. Prin urmare, compatibil atât cu utilizatori cu experiență, cât și cu experiență.
  • Permite un index mai rapid la datele rezumate anterior.

Dezavantaje ale MOLAP

  • MOLAP nu conține informații detaliate despre date, prin urmare, este compatibil pentru cei care trebuie să se ocupe de informații detaliate despre date.
  • Utilizarea stocării MOLAP este scăzută dacă seturile de date sunt împrăștiate.

Comparație dintre capete în cap între ROLAP și MOLAP (Infografie)

Mai jos este topul 9 comparativ între ROLAP și MOLAP:

Diferența cheie între ROLAP și MOLAP

ROLAP vs MOLAP sunt ambele forme ale OLAP. Să discutăm câteva diferențe cheie importante între ele.

  • ROLAP este o procesare analitică online relațională, în timp ce MOLAP este o prelucrare analitică online multidimensională.
  • Datele din ROLAP sunt relaționale. pe de altă parte, Datele sunt ierarhice.
  • ROLAP a stocat o cantitate mare de date, cu toate acestea MOLAP stochează o cantitate limitată de date și păstrează date rezumate în baze de date multidimensionale.
  • Atât ROLAP, cât și MOLAP sunt stocate în depozitul principal de date, dar ROLAP stochează și preia date din depozitul principal de date, în timp ce MOLAP stochează și preia datele din bazele de date cu mai multe dimensiuni.
  • ROLAP a stocat date sub forma unei baze de date relaționale, dar în MOLAP, datele stocate sub formă de cuburi de date multidimensionale bazate pe matrice.
  • Deoarece datele din ROLAP sunt stocate într-o bază de date relațională, putem vizualiza datele în timp real. În timp ce în MOLAP este stocat în cuburi de date, nu există nicio conexiune în timp real cu baza de date, de aceea trebuie să actualizăm frecvent datele.
  • Scalabilitatea serverelor ROLAP este mai mare comparativ cu serverele din MOLAP.
  • viteza de răspuns ROLAP la întrebări este lentă, în timp ce în cazul MOLAP viteza de răspuns la întrebări este rapidă în comparație cu ROLAP.
  • ROLAP utilizează interogări SQL complexe pentru a prelua datele din depozitul principal de date, în timp ce, în cazul MOLAP, creează cuburi de date pentru a prelua datele de la dimensiunile multiple. Pentru a gestiona datele MOLAP folosește tehnologia matricială împrăștiată pentru a prelua datele.
  • ROLAP creează dinamic o vizualizare multidimensională a datelor, MOLAP stochează deja datele sub formă de matrice multidimensională în baze de date multidimensionale

Tabelul de comparație între ROLAP și MOLAP:

Să discutăm cea mai mare diferență între ROLAP și MOLAP

ObiectiveROLAPMOLAP
Formular completROLAP este o procesare analitică relațională online.MOLAP este o prelucrare analitică online multidimensională.
Cantitatea stocărilor de dateROLAP stochează o cantitate mare de dateStochează o cantitate limitată de date și păstrează date rezumate în baze de date multidimensionale.
Sursa de dateROLAP stochează și preia datele din depozitul principal de date.MOLAP stochează și preia datele din bazele de date cu dimensiuni multiple.
Forma de stocare a datelorA stocat date sub forma unei baze de date relaționale.Stochează date sub formă de cuburi de date multidimensionale bazate pe matrice.
Viteza de răspunsViteza de răspuns este lentăViteza de răspuns este rapidă
Tehnologia folosităUtilizează interogări SQL complexe pentru a prelua datele din depozitul de date.Creează cuburi de date pentru a prelua datele din mai multe dimensiuni. Pentru tratarea datelor se utilizează tehnologia matricială împrăștiată.
Vizualizarea datelorCreează dinamic o vizualizare multidimensională a datelor.Acesta stochează deja datele sub forma unui tablou multidimensional în baze de date multidimensionale.
LatențăScăzutÎnalt
Facilitatea DBMSPuternicSlab

Concluzie

Aplicarea și implementarea ROLAP vs MOLAP depind de complexitatea datelor și de performanța ambelor modele. Dacă un utilizator dorește să stocheze date mari, atunci ROLAP este recomandat. Întrucât MOLAP este sugerat atunci când un utilizator dorește o procesare mai rapidă. Deoarece ROLAP creează o vizualizare multidimensională a datelor în mod dinamic, procesează date mai lent decât MOLAP, care nu creează o vizualizare multidimensională a datelor.

Articole recomandate

Acesta a fost un ghid pentru diferența maximă dintre ROLAP și MOLAP. Aici vom discuta, de asemenea, despre diferențele cheie ROLAP și MOLAP cu infografie și tabel de comparație. De asemenea, puteți arunca o privire la următoarele articole pentru a afla mai multe -

  1. Testarea fumului și testarea sanității
  2. Scrum vs Kanban - Top Differences
  3. Instrumente OLAP
  4. Data Warehouse vs Hadoop
  5. ROLAP vs MOLAP vs HOLAP
  6. Ce este Sanity Testing și cum funcționează?

Categorie: